The Tropics return home for a 13-game home stand. They play the first nine games, take a break with the All-Star Game, then play the final four games. The first team in Hawaii is San Fernando for a three-game series.

Game 1- The San Fernando Bears offense mauls Hawaii’s pitching staff for 14 runs on 15 hits and 3 walks. Tropics pitchers couldn’t keep the Bears out the trash bins as every pitcher that took the mound took a hit. It began with John Moore allowing six runs on four hits and three walks in 4.2 innings. He struck out three as he falls to 0-3 with a 6.51 ERA. Bill Ritz got his fingers too close to the cage as he was bit for two runs on two hits and a K in 1.1 innings. Chih Kuang was awful allowing three runs on six hits. He struck out a batter in 1.2 innings of work. Phil Thompson was the last victim as he gave up three runs on three hits while fanning two batters in 1.1 innings.

The offense wasn’t bad but again didn’t take advantage of walks or errors. They managed just four runs on five hits while drawing eight walks and striking out just three times. LF Vicente Mendez was 2 for 4 with a three-run homer (1) in the 6th inning. He scored two runs and drove in three on the day. CF Angelo Lucchesi was 1 for 5 with a stolen base (2) and scored a run. 1B Karunamaya Makarand was 1 for 3 with a stolen base (5) and scored a run.



San Fernando wins 14-4.

Game 2- The Tropics strike for two runs in the 1st inning, but the Bears claw their way back with a six-run 3rd inning. The Trops chipped aways at the lead with a run in the 5th and five more in the 7th to take the lead. That lasted until the top of the 8th when the Bears scored four runs against Hawaii reliever Bill Phillips. Phillips gave up those runs on four hits and a walk in 2/3 of an inning. He struck out a batter as he falls to 3-5 with a 4.15 ERA. The Tropics mounted a final comeback try in the bottom of the 9th but could push across one run before the final out.

Hawaii pitcher Bill Williams kept the San Fernando offense quite for two innings before he melted down. He allowed six runs on five hits, three of which were homers, and two walks. He struck out one batter in a no decision. Utkan Gocek came out the bullpen slinging heat as he allowed just two hits in two innings. The ‘Teddy Bear’ came into the game as tamed the Bears in 2.1 scoreless innings. He gave up three hits and fanned two batters.

The Hawaii offense put up enough runs to win except for this any game this season. 1B Tomas Borges had the biggest hit of the day with a Grand Slam in the 7th inning. 2B Adhyapayana Mehta was 2 for 4 with a double (13), scored two runs and had an RBI. Vicente Mendez was 2 for 4 with a walk and scored two runs. Is Mendez back or is this a mirage?



San Fernando wins 10-9.

Game 3- The Bears win their fifth straight game and complete the sweep of the Tropics. Hawaii can’t win offensively, defensively or with pitching. The Trops held the Bears down to two runs on six hits and four walks, but Hawaii’s offense managed just one runs on three hits and four walk.

Hawaii starter Manny Ortiz pitched 4.1 innings allowing a run on five hits and a walk with two Ks. Phil Thompson made his 2nd appearance of the series and gave up a run on a solo homer in 2.1 innings pitched. He struck out a batter and he falls to 0-3 with a 4.14 ERA.

Hawaii scored their lone run on a solo homer in the 2nd inning by Tomas Borges.



San Fernando wins 2-1.



The Bears sweep the three-game series.



GM Jim Walker said, “The Bears are a good team and they’re on the rise. Our team is a shitshow. I’ve had a talk with Rich Kerr and he’s gonna change some things up.”
